Transaction d4d121fc215cd93ca4ea82f3b8da26f637657e45f57c23d14cb02ed95879ca91
1 Input
1 Output
-
d4d121fc215cd93ca4ea82f3b8da26f637657e45f57c23d14cb02ed95879ca91:0
- value
- 30539438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b474293ad5969dae98a744ca5e383e08337475f OP_EQUAL
- address
- 3LDrTioQKcdojpdJHSeCW7aX83i1pqvuzy